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
349400422 029496 0917870 75
13 331
13 331
455 998209069 78 6004 80847828
All about undefined
Interested in learning more?
13 331
455 998209069 78 6004 80847828
See more
49263020344 21 55
5347990 8213 64597657
See more
193053828 62644709955 502
389158313 936 147683
See more